Vraća serijski broj iz niza koji predstavlja određeni datum.
Sintaksa
DATE(godina;mjesec;dan)
Godina Argument godina može biti od jedne do četiri znamenke. Ako je godina između 0 (nula) i 1899 (uključujući obje vrijednosti), vrijednost se dodaje na 1900 radi izračuna godine. Na primjer, DATE(108,1,2) vraća 2. siječnja 2008. (1900+108). Ako je godina između 1900 i 9999 (uključujući obje vrijednosti), vrijednost se koristi kao godina. Na primjer, DATE(2008,1,2) vraća 2. siječnja 2008.
Mjesec je broj koji predstavlja mjesec u godini. Ako je mjesec veći od 12, mjesec taj broj mjeseci dodaje prvom mjesecu navedene godine. Na primjer, DATE(2008,14,2) vraća serijski broj koji predstavlja 2. veljače 2009.
Dan je broj koji predstavlja dan u mjesecu. Ako je dan veći od broja dana u navedenom mjesecu, dan taj broj dana dodaje prvom danu u mjesecu. Na primjer, DATE(2008,1,35) vraća serijski broj koji predstavlja 4. veljače 2008.
Napomene
-
Datumi se spremaju kao serijski brojevi u nizu da bi se mogli koristiti u izračunima. Prema zadanim postavkama 31. prosinca 1899. serijski je broj 1, a 1. siječnja 2008. serijski je broj 39448 jer se nalazi 39 448 dana nakon 1. siječnja 1900.
-
Funkcija DATE najkorisniji je u formulama u kojima su godina, mjesec i dan formule, a ne konstante.
Primjer
Godina |
Mjesec |
Dan |
Formula |
Opis (rezultat) |
---|---|---|---|---|
2008 |
1 |
1 |
=DATE([Godina];[Mjesec];[dan]) |
Serijski datum za datum (1. 1. 2008. ili 39448.) |